19. Muscles attached to bones support your body to provide stability and balance.

Health
1 answer:
Zarrin [17]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

True

Explanation:

They are a part of the musculoskeletal system which helps provide form, stability, support, and movement.

Which is an important risk factor for drug abuse?
Illusion [34]
Risk Factors for Drug Abuse: Academic failure or lack of academic motivation. Alienation from peers or family. Anti-social behavior, including early aggressive behavior.
